Output 907972a4be2b9c50841538cc46133021d32a1845bcfbc6d674730bc138469f2d:2

value
18384723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b6f3498589a6ad78a25baebb4ce342712abf86d OP_EQUAL
address
32jUaLuRR14sVAv7JxAf5GZPqADKZ3Vw4q
transaction
907972a4be2b9c50841538cc46133021d32a1845bcfbc6d674730bc138469f2d
spent
true